Analysis
In 2024, imports of goods and services (current lcu), per capita in Belize stood at 8,257 current LCU per person.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.
That represents a change of up 8.0% on the previous year and up 30.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, imports of goods and services (current lcu), per capita in Belize peaked at 8,257 current LCU per person in 2024 and was at its lowest, 1,332 current LCU per person, in 1985.
Belize ranks 168th of 193 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 45 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Imports of goods and services (current LCU)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Imports of goods and services (current LCU)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Imports of goods and services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s)
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
